What Is Patent Database Benchmarking?

Patent database benchmarking is a structured process used to assess and compare patent information platforms based on parameters relevant to business, legal, and research needs. The goal is to select the tool—or combination of tools—that best supports your organization’s decision-making processes, from competitive intelligence and whitespace analysis to patent prosecution and monetization.

This approach involves evaluating each database across several performance dimensions, such as:

  • Jurisdictional and temporal data coverage
  • Legal status accuracy and update frequency
  • Search and filtering precision
  • Machine learning or AI-enhanced functionalities
  • Integration with internal systems or APIs
  • Visualization and analytical reporting tools
  • User experience, scalability, and support services
  • Licensing terms and cost-effectiveness

Benchmarking does not aim to crown a universal winner. Instead, it aligns a platform’s capabilities with your organization’s objectives and workflows.

Why You Should Care?

1. Patent Data Quality Is Not Uniform

Many users assume that all patent databases pull from the same global sources and are, therefore, interchangeable. In reality, the depth of coverage, translation quality, classification precision, and update latency can differ widely—even for the same jurisdiction. These discrepancies can materially impact decisions.

For example, if you’re relying on a database that lacks up-to-date family linkages or has inconsistent assignee normalization, your competitor benchmarking or FTO analysis may miss critical elements. The cost of a missed patent can translate into wasted R&D, legal vulnerability, or lost licensing opportunities.

2. Use Cases Vary—So Should Your Toolset

A single database may perform well in terms of search precision but fail to deliver on analytics or workflow integration. Patent attorneys, competitive intelligence teams, R&D engineers, and licensing professionals all interact with patent data differently. Benchmarking ensures that the tool is well-suited for the task, whether it involves prior art searching, identifying whitespace, or tracking technology trends.

Companies with mature IP functions often opt for multi-database strategies, using different platforms for distinct purposes. Without benchmarking, such investments become fragmented and poorly optimized.

3. Costs Accumulate Quickly Without Strategic Oversight

Patent databases often operate under multi-seat or enterprise-wide licenses, incurring significant annual costs. Yet, many companies overpay for features they rarely use or duplicate functionality across platforms.

By benchmarking, organisations can quantify the value of each feature and use case, renegotiate licenses, or eliminate tools that no longer meet their performance expectations. This approach not only helps in planning for future scalability as your team expands or as your R&D strategy enters new markets but also empowers you to optimise costs and make informed strategic decisions.

4. AI and Analytics Are Not Always Equal

Many patent databases now claim to offer artificial intelligence or machine learning features. However, benchmarking these tools reveals meaningful differences in how those features are implemented—and how useful they are in real-world scenarios.

Some platforms utilise AI to enhance metadata and facilitate semantic search capabilities. Others offer more advanced capabilities, such as automated clustering, patent strength scoring, or litigation prediction. These enhancements should be measured, validated, and tested, not assumed based on marketing language.

How to Benchmark Patent Databases?

An effective benchmarking project doesn’t require a massive consulting budget or a year-long study. It requires clarity, collaboration, and structured testing. Here’s how leading IP and R&D teams typically approach the process:

Step 1: Map Internal Needs by Function

Different roles have different data needs. Work with stakeholders from legal, R&D, licensing, and strategy to document:

  • What questions they’re trying to answer
  • Which features do they use frequently
  • Which jurisdictions or technologies matter most
  • Current pain points with existing tools

This mapping ensures that the benchmarking process accurately reflects actual user workflows rather than just technical specifications.

Step 2: Build a Criteria-Based Scorecard

Develop a structured framework with weighted performance indicators, such as:

  • Coverage (jurisdictions, patent types, historical data)
  • Update frequency (grants, legal status, ownership changes)
  • Search capabilities (Boolean, semantic, proximity)
  • Usability (interface design, training resources)
  • AI features (clustering, keyword extraction, recommendations)
  • Export formats and integration options
  • License model and cost transparency

This step will help turn subjective preferences into comparable performance scores.

Step 3: Use Case Simulations

Select 2–3 high-priority use cases (e.g., FTO search in a niche tech field, tracking competitor filings, identifying expired patents) and run them across the shortlisted tools. Document:

  • Time to retrieve results
  • Completeness of output
  • Ease of filtering and post-processing
  • Ability to generate and export insights

The goal is to evaluate platforms under practical pressure—not just marketing demos.

Step 4: Analyze Tradeoffs and Make Recommendations

With testing complete, consolidate your results and identify the following:

  • The top performer overall
  • The best tool per functional use case
  • Any areas where two or more tools should be combined
  • Potential cost savings or negotiation leverage

Make your recommendations with supporting evidence, not assumptions. This step will guide and support your decision-making process, ensuring that your final choices are based on a thorough and objective evaluation.

Step 5: Review Periodically

Technology shifts, IP strategies evolve, and new jurisdictions emerge as innovation hubs. To ensure that your tools continue to match your changing needs, it’s essential to set a recurring cadence—ideally every 18–24 months—to re-run simplified benchmarking. This practice will provide you with the reassurance and confidence that your strategy is always up to date.
